Value for Money

AAG's 2025-2026 fee structure is published transparently on the school website and conforms with KHDA regulations. Fees range from AED 36,485 for Pre-KG to AED 65,270 for Grades 9 through 12 - a spread that makes this one of the more accessible premium American curriculum schools in Dubai. The KHDA's own fee data for the 2025-2026 cycle shows slightly different figures (AED 45,618 for Pre-primary through KG2, scaling to AED 71,113 for Grades 9-12); the school's own published fee schedule is the primary reference for parents and is used as the basis for this review's fee table. Payment is structured across three terms: Term 1 fees are due by 2nd August, Term 2 by 6th December, and Term 3 by 14th March. New students pay a non-refundable application fee of AED 525 (inclusive of 5% VAT) and a registration fee of AED 4,000 or 10% of annual tuition (whichever applies), credited against Term 1. Returning students pay a re-registration fee of AED 2,000 or 5% of annual tuition. Books are provided on a loan basis and returned at the end of term or academic year - a meaningful saving compared to schools that require annual book purchases. A sibling discount of 10% applies to the third (youngest) and subsequent child in a family paying full fees and attending any Taaleem school in Dubai - a group-level benefit that rewards loyalty across the network. Emirates NBD and Mastercard credit card holders can convert school payments into 0% instalment plans, and Taaleem offers additional benefits to Emirates airline employees. On value for money, AAG sits in a defensible position. At AED 36,485 to AED 65,270, it is priced below many Dubai American curriculum competitors, while offering NEASC accreditation, AP courses, a 1:10 teacher ratio, and the unique positioning of a girls-only environment. The loan book scheme, absence of a debenture, and accessible sibling discount further improve the total cost of ownership. The school is not cheap - and transport, uniforms, and ECA fees add to the base cost - but for what it delivers, the fee-to-provision ratio is reasonable. Parents seeking an affordable entry into the American curriculum track in Dubai, within a values-driven, single-gender school, will find AAG among the most competitively priced credentialed options available.
